Ding a little digging and research in ye olde reliable source of wikipedia it looks like the brand was bought by Pacific Cycles in 2009. It looks like they did the same thing for Schwinn and GT back in 2001.

when Pacific bought the bankrupt GT they said explicitly they would be concentrating on the sub $500 big retailer market (I had an I-drive at the time that needed spares so followed it all closely). Given theyre now doing carbon fibre zaskars and stuff like this high tech hi price monster
there may be hope for Ironhorse if Pacific think the brand has enough heritage to carry high price high profit bikes.
